*SOCCER: Cristiane scored in the 75th minute to give Brazil a 3-2 win over Australia on Sunday and its second berth in the semifinals of the women’s World Cup in Tianjin, China. … Casagrande, a star striker for Brazil on its 1986 World Cup team, was injured in a car accident Saturday night in Sao Paulo, Brazil, and was hospitalized in stable condition. … Carlos Tevez and Louis Saha scored as Manchester United defeated Chelsea 2-0 in the English Premier League in Chelsea’s first match after the departure of manager Jose Mourinho.

*GOLF: Steve Flesch shot a 1-over 73 and beat Michael Allen by two shots to win the Turning Stone Resort Championship in Verona, N.Y, with an 18-under 270 total. It was his second PGA Tour victory in two months. … Mark Wiebe became the 12th player to win his Champions Tour debut, closing with a 5-under 67 for a tournament-record 18-under 198 total in Cary, N.C.

*CYCLING: Russian cyclist Denis Menchov won the Spanish Vuelta for the second time in three years, beating Carlos Sastre of Team CSC by 3 minutes 31 seconds.

*NHL: Lightning defenseman Dan Boyle is expected to miss four to six weeks after undergoing wrist surgery. Boyle got hurt in a freak accident Saturday after an exhibition loss to the Capitals. Boyle was distracted while hanging up his skate. The skate slipped off the hook and hit Boyle’s left wrist, severing three tendons.

*WRESTLING: American Kristie Marano won her ninth World Wrestling Championships medal on the last day of the event in Baku, Azerbaijan. Marano received a silver after losing to Stank Zlateva of Bulgaria at 158.5 pounds.
